What Are Attenuation Tanks, and How Do They Work?

Attenuation tanks, also known as stormwater tanks, are critical infrastructure designed to manage excess rainwater in areas prone to flooding, especially during heavy rainfall. They work by temporarily storing runoff water collected from roofs, driveways, and other impervious surfaces, preventing it from overwhelming local drainage systems.

This stored water is then gradually released at a controlled rate into the storm drain system or directly into the environment, significantly reducing the risk of flooding and minimising the impact on surrounding areas. The effectiveness of attenuation tanks largely depends on their design and installation. Typically constructed from materials like concrete, plastic, or steel, these tanks are advanced and durable.

The size and capacity of the tank are determined based on the catchment area and the anticipated volume of runoff water. Advanced systems may also have filters and separators to improve water quality before it is discharged, enhancing environmental protection efforts and ensuring compliance with regulatory standards.

What is the Average Cost of an Attenuation Tank Per M3?

On average, the cost of an attenuation tank per M3 ranges from €200 to €500. This price includes the tank itself but may not cover installation fees, which can vary based on the site conditions and the amount of preparatory work required. It’s essential for potential buyers to consider the full scope of expenses involved, from purchasing to installation and maintenance.

In addition to the initial costs, long-term factors such as maintenance and operational costs also play a crucial role in the total cost of ownership of an attenuation tank. Regular maintenance is necessary to ensure the efficiency and longevity of the tank, involving periodic cleaning and inspection to prevent blockages and wear.

What Are the Benefits of Attenuation Tanks?

Attenuation tanks provide a range of environmental, economic, and operational benefits that make them a valuable addition to urban and rural stormwater management systems. Here’s how they contribute positively:

Flood Risk Reduction

One of the primary advantages of attenuation tanks is their ability to significantly reduce the risk of flooding. By capturing and controlling the release of stormwater, these tanks prevent sudden surges in water flow that can overwhelm drainage systems and lead to flooding. This controlled release helps maintain a balance in the water systems, especially during extreme weather conditions.

Improved Water Quality

Attenuation tanks can be equipped with filtration systems that help remove pollutants from runoff water before it is released back into the environment. This process not only protects local waterways from contamination but also helps in maintaining ecological balance and support biodiversity in aquatic ecosystems.

Infrastructure Protection

By managing the volume and flow rate of stormwater, attenuation tanks protect existing water infrastructure from being overloaded during heavy rainfall. This extends the lifespan of drainage systems and reduces the need for frequent maintenance or upgrades, thereby saving on long-term infrastructure costs.

Regulatory Compliance

Many regions have regulations requiring the management of stormwater to prevent environmental degradation. Attenuation tanks help in complying with these regulations by effectively managing the runoff, thus avoiding potential legal issues and penalties for non-compliance.

Versatility and Scalability

Attenuation tanks come in various sizes and materials, offering flexibility in design and installation to suit different sites and needs. Whether it’s a small residential area or a large industrial complex, these systems can be scaled and adapted to meet specific requirements, making them a versatile solution for managing stormwater.

What Factors Affect the Cost of Attenuation Tank Per M3?

There are a variety of factors affecting the cost of installing an attenuation tank. Understanding these can help you budget more accurately for your project. Here are the main factors:

Material Costs

The choice of material significantly impacts the overall cost of attenuation tanks. Concrete tanks are generally more expensive, ranging from €250 to €400 per M3 due to their durability and strength. Plastic tanks, while less durable, are more cost-effective, with prices between €150 and €300 per M3. Steel tanks, offering a balance between durability and cost, typically range from €200 to €350 per M3.

Size and Capacity

Larger tanks naturally cost more due to the increased materials and labour required for installation. The cost per M3 generally decreases with larger tanks due to economies of scale. For example, a small tank might cost around €500 per M3, whereas a larger tank might reduce the cost to about €300 per M3 due to these efficiencies.

Installation Complexity

The complexity of the installation process can significantly affect the cost. Factors such as site accessibility, ground conditions, and the need for site preparation can increase labour and equipment costs.

For instance, installations in areas with poor accessibility or requiring extensive excavation might add an additional €100 to €200 per M3 to the overall cost.

Additional Features

Features such as integrated filtration systems, overflow mechanisms, and advanced control systems can add to the cost. These features are essential for enhancing the functionality of the tank but can increase the price by €50 to €150 per M3, depending on the complexity and quality of the systems installed.

Regulatory Compliance and Permits

The need to comply with local building and environmental regulations can also influence costs. Compliance might require specific design modifications or additional components that increase costs. Additionally, the fees for obtaining necessary permits can vary, typically adding €200 to €500 to the total project cost, depending on local regulations.

Frequently Asked Questions

What is the average cost of an attenuation tank per m3 in Ireland?

The average cost typically ranges from €200 to €500 per m3. This range depends on factors such as material, size, and additional features.

How does the size of the tank impact its cost per m3?

Larger tanks generally reduce the cost per due to economies of scale. Smaller tanks might cost around €500 per m3, while larger tanks could lower the cost to approximately €300 per m3.

What long-term costs should be considered when investing in an attenuation tank?

Maintenance and operational costs, including regular cleaning and inspection to prevent blockages and ensure longevity, should be factored into the total cost of ownership.

What are the environmental benefits of installing an attenuation tank?

Besides flood risk reduction, attenuation tanks can improve water quality by filtering out pollutants before they are released, which helps protect local waterways and supports biodiversity.

Do attenuation tanks require regular maintenance, and what are the costs involved?

Yes, regular maintenance is necessary to ensure optimal function and longevity. This may include periodic cleaning and inspections, with costs varying depending on the tank size and accessibility, typically ranging from €100 to €300 annually.

What is the expected lifespan of an attenuation tank in Ireland?

The lifespan of an attenuation tank depends on the material and maintenance, but typically ranges from 20 to 40 years. Proper installation and regular maintenance are crucial for maximising the tank’s lifespan.
